ISLAMABAD (DI NEWS) : China and Pakistan signed an agreement in Beijing between Hazza Institute of Technology and NAVTTC to boost vocational, technical, and professional training under the China-Pakistan Economic Corridor (CPEC). Planning Minister Ahsan Iqbal highlighted that the next phase of CPEC will focus on business-to-business cooperation and industrialization, aiming to create 1,000 new jobs in the coming years. He stressed that Pakistan’s youth, with two-thirds of the population under 30, must be equipped with future-ready skills in AI, robotics, big data, green technology, and advanced manufacturing to seize opportunities of the fourth industrial revolution. The Uraan Pakistan Program, aligned with China’s successful vocational model, will develop skill centers, promote technology transfer, and enhance youth employability, turning Pakistan’s demographic potential into economic power and driving sustainable industrial growth.
